Church of Our Lady Mary of Zion
The holiest church in Ethiopia, believed to house the Ark of the Covenant.
King Ezana's Stele
A 24-meter-tall granite obelisk from the 4th century AD, part of the Axumite stelae field.
Ezana Stone
The Ezana Stone is a 4th-century stele inscribed with the conversion of King Ezana to Christianity, marking a pivotal moment in Ethiopian history.
Dungur
Dungur is the ruins of a 6th-century palace traditionally linked to the Queen of Sheba, offering a glimpse into Axumite royal life.
Lioness of Gobedra
The Lioness of Gobedra is a massive ancient rock carving of a lioness on a hillside near Axum, a rare example of pre-Christian Axumite art.
